Have a buddy who has about 100 miles on his 17 Pro and he says there's oil splattered under the hood. On the right side, by the coolant bottle and up by the steering post (see pics). He says it's definitely not coolant and it's not the same black oil that leaks out of the exhaust when these things are brand new. It's got the same consistency and color and as it does right out of the jug. Any ideas?